Lauren and her husband David live with their two boys, Danny and Finley.
2-year-old Finley has a rare genetic condition; Lauren and her family use the nursing service provided by the Pepper Foundation and Rennie Grove Hospice Care. The support provided by the nursing team gives Lauren and David some cherished family time.
“Finley’s condition means that he needs a considerable amount of support, including through the night. We have to change Finley’s physical position regularly to make sure he is comfortable as he isn’t able to move on his own. At night, Finley sleeps with a breathing apparatus.
Since the pandemic, I have been so anxious about coronavirus because Finley is very vulnerable. A nurse that the Pepper Foundation fund visits our home for three hours a week; this time is precious to us as it means David and I can spend some quality time with Finley’s older brother, Danny.
The support from The Pepper Foundation and the nurses is incredible; the nurses really understand the day-to-day struggles and the worries we face. They are like our extended family and are always there, day or night, to give us advice or check on Finley when we need them.”

The Children’s Hospice at Home Service
Our children’s hospice at home nursing service is a partnership with Rennie Grove Hospice Care; the nursing is partly funded by The Pepper Foundation and managed by Rennie Grove Hospice Care. During the Covid-19 pandemic when families have the potential to be cut off from help, the service we fund has become more important than ever.
The nursing team offers specialist palliative care for children and young people who have a life-threatening or life-limiting illness. The nurses also provide emotional support, respite care, and advice for families.
